Solution for 4x^2+11xy+7y^2=0 equation:


Simplifying
4x2 + 11xy + 7y2 = 0

Reorder the terms:
11xy + 4x2 + 7y2 = 0

Solving
11xy + 4x2 + 7y2 = 0

Solving for variable 'x'.

Factor a trinomial.
(x + y)(4x + 7y)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(x + y)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ying x + y = 0 Solving x + y =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1y' to each side of the equation. x + y + -1y = 0 + -1y Combine like terms: y + -1y = 0 x + 0 = 0 + -1y x = 0 + -1y Remove the zero: x = -1y Simplifying x = -1y

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(4x + 7y)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 4x + 7y = 0 Solving 4x + 7y =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-7y' to each side of the equation. 4x + 7y + -7y = 0 + -7y Combine like terms: 7y + -7y = 0 4x + 0 = 0 + -7y 4x = 0 + -7y Remove the zero: 4x = -7y Divide each side by '4'. x = -1.75y Simplifying x = -1.75y

Solution

x = {-1y, -1.75y}
